Change Local Account Password Using Settings. If you are using a Local User Account, you can follow the steps below to change User Password in Windows 10. Go to Settings > Accounts > select Sign-in Options in the left pane. In the right pane, scroll down and select the Password option and click on the Change button. WebChange MySQL user password using the SET PASSWORD statement The second way to change the password is by using the SET PASSWORD statement. You use the user account in user@host format to update the password. If you need to change the password for other accounts, your account needs to have at least UPDATE privilege. WebSNMP v3 uses safer user name/password authentication, along with an encryption key. By convention, most SNMP v1/v2c equipment ships with a read-only community string set to the value public. It is standard practice for network managers to change all the community strings to customized values during device setup.
